Zimbabwe African National Union-Patriotic Front chairman Simon Khaya Moyo has reportedly been cleared for the post of Vice-President. The post became vacant following the death of John Nkomo. The post has traditionally been filled by a person from the former Zimbabwe African People’s Union, but it had been hoped that after more than 20-yearsof unity this pattern might be disbanded.
